Is thalassemia a neurological disorder? Unpacking the link between blood and nerve health

4 min read
While thalassemia is primarily defined as a genetic blood disorder, it can profoundly impact the nervous system, leading to a spectrum of complications. Reports have demonstrated neurological involvement in many patients, with issues ranging from cognitive impairment and nerve damage to an increased risk of stroke. This happens despite the disorder not originating in the brain or spinal cord, underscoring the interconnectedness of blood health and neurological function.

What organ does TTP affect? A comprehensive guide

4 min read
TTP is a rare and life-threatening blood disorder caused by the formation of tiny blood clots throughout the body. This condition, known as Thrombotic Thrombocytopenic Purpura (TTP), can profoundly affect the function of multiple vital organs.
